Job Description

A dynamic educational environment in Detroit, MI is seeking a dedicated professional to fill a vital role in supporting diverse student needs. This position focuses on creating inclusive and enriching learning experiences for K-12 students within a multicultural academy.

Qualifications:

  • Valid Special Education Teacher License in Michigan
  • Strong understanding of various disabilities and tailored educational strategies
  • Bilingual in Arabic and/or Spanish preferred, but not required
  • Experience working with diverse student populations, particularly English Language learners
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ills

Location: Detroit, MI

Responsibilities:

  • Develop and implement Program Service Plans (PSPs) for students with special needs
  • Directly service students, ensuring individualized support and guidance
  • Collaborate with educational staff to enhance the overall learning environment
  • Manage administrative tasks related to special education processes
  • Foster positive relationships with students, parents, and staff, promoting an inclusive culture
